初始化當(dāng)前當(dāng)前線程的looper。并且標(biāo)記為一個(gè)程序的主Looper。由Android環(huán)境來(lái)創(chuàng)建應(yīng)用程序的主Looper。因此這個(gè)方法不能由咱們來(lái)調(diào)用。
創(chuàng)新互聯(lián)建站是一家專注網(wǎng)站建設(shè)、網(wǎng)絡(luò)營(yíng)銷策劃、成都小程序開(kāi)發(fā)、電子商務(wù)建設(shè)、網(wǎng)絡(luò)推廣、移動(dòng)互聯(lián)開(kāi)發(fā)、研究、服務(wù)為一體的技術(shù)型公司。公司成立10余年以來(lái),已經(jīng)為1000多家樓梯護(hù)欄各業(yè)的企業(yè)公司提供互聯(lián)網(wǎng)服務(wù)?,F(xiàn)在,服務(wù)的1000多家客戶與我們一路同行,見(jiàn)證我們的成長(zhǎng);未來(lái),我們一起分享成功的喜悅。
接收Looper從MessageQueue取出Handler所送來(lái)的消息。
線程通過(guò)java的標(biāo)準(zhǔn)對(duì)象Thread 創(chuàng)建. Android 提供了很多方便的管理線程的方法:— Looper 在線程中運(yùn)行一個(gè)消息循環(huán); Handler 傳遞一個(gè)消息; HandlerThread 創(chuàng)建一個(gè)帶有消息循環(huán)的線程。
android中是使用Looper機(jī)制來(lái)完成消息循環(huán)的,但每次創(chuàng)建線程時(shí)都先初始化Looper比較麻煩,因此Android為我們提供了一個(gè)HandlerThread類,他封裝了Looper對(duì)象,是我們不用關(guān)心Looper的開(kāi)啟和釋放問(wèn)題。
MessageQueue:消息隊(duì)列,用來(lái)存放Handler發(fā)送過(guò)來(lái)的消息,并按照FIFO規(guī)則執(zhí)行。當(dāng)然,存放Message并非實(shí)際意義的保存,而是將Message以鏈表的方式串聯(lián)起來(lái)的,等待Looper的抽取。
通過(guò)調(diào)用Looper.prepare()方法可以創(chuàng)建Looper對(duì)象和MessageQueue對(duì)象,調(diào)用Looper.loop()方法可以啟動(dòng)消息循環(huán)隊(duì)列。
1、首先需要在華為手機(jī)桌面上找到“圖庫(kù)”應(yīng)用,這款應(yīng)用是系統(tǒng)自帶的。雙擊打開(kāi)應(yīng)用就能看到本地圖片和視頻了,如果是視頻的話,則會(huì)看到下圖所示的播放按鍵。
2、打開(kāi)播放器OPlayer,點(diǎn)擊右上角的三點(diǎn)符號(hào) 點(diǎn)擊打開(kāi)設(shè)置。進(jìn)入設(shè)置頁(yè)面點(diǎn)擊控制。進(jìn)入控制頁(yè)面,點(diǎn)擊勾選通話結(jié)束后繼續(xù)播放。方法二:先把視頻添加到播放列表,按“播放”按鈕開(kāi)始播放。
3、有些手機(jī)自帶循環(huán)播放功能,可以在相冊(cè)里打開(kāi)視頻,在視頻播放設(shè)置里開(kāi)啟循環(huán)播放。沒(méi)有此功能的手機(jī)可以下載一款第三方播放軟件,然后使用播放器播放,將其設(shè)置成單片循環(huán)即可。
4、首先打開(kāi)該手機(jī)自帶的圖庫(kù)點(diǎn)擊進(jìn)入,并找到相冊(cè)接著在相冊(cè)中找到相冊(cè)視頻,其次點(diǎn)擊播放其中一個(gè)視頻,播放時(shí)再點(diǎn)擊一個(gè)屏幕并找到右上角的圖標(biāo)單擊最后在出現(xiàn)的選項(xiàng)里找到播放設(shè)置那欄,點(diǎn)擊全部循環(huán)即可。
5、沒(méi)有此功能的手機(jī)可以下載一款第三方播放軟件,然后使用播放器播放,將其設(shè)置成單片循環(huán)即可。方法如下:打開(kāi)視頻手機(jī)進(jìn)入騰訊視頻后,隨意打開(kāi)一個(gè)視頻進(jìn)行播放。打開(kāi)編輯進(jìn)入視頻播放頁(yè)面后,打開(kāi)編輯。
6、點(diǎn)擊我的之后依次進(jìn)入到手機(jī)的設(shè)置頁(yè)面下。我們把連續(xù)播放開(kāi)啟就可以了。循環(huán)播放的主要工作:循環(huán)播放是指一段音頻或視頻在播放到末尾時(shí)自動(dòng)從頭開(kāi)始,不間斷地重復(fù)播放。
adapter可以處理itemview布局和無(wú)限輪播; LayoutManager 可以處理整體布局和滑動(dòng)動(dòng)畫(huà);SnapHelper可以讓itemview滑動(dòng)起來(lái)像viewpager一樣(一般用自帶的 PagerSnapHelper 就行了)。
一個(gè)自動(dòng)滾動(dòng),輪播循環(huán)視圖組件。使用(1) 引入公共庫(kù)引入Android Auto Scroll ViewPager@Github作為你項(xiàng)目的library(如何拉取代碼及添加公共庫(kù))。
點(diǎn)開(kāi)(圖庫(kù)),點(diǎn)開(kāi)(視頻),點(diǎn)開(kāi)某一段視頻,點(diǎn)播放,點(diǎn)右上角的三個(gè)小點(diǎn),出來(lái)一個(gè)頁(yè)面,點(diǎn)上面的(播放設(shè)置)的(單片循環(huán)),然后就可以看到該視頻不斷重復(fù)播放了。
設(shè)置動(dòng)畫(huà)的舞臺(tái)HTML與之前文章里的示例非常相似。
這個(gè)廣告位banner是典型的AndroidViewPager實(shí)現(xiàn),要解決一系列問(wèn)題,比如:這個(gè)廣告位ViewPager要支持無(wú)限循環(huán)輪播。ViewPager要實(shí)現(xiàn)自動(dòng)播放,比如每個(gè)若干秒如2秒,自動(dòng)切換播放到下一張圖片。
分享名稱:android循環(huán)操作 android循環(huán)執(zhí)行網(wǎng)絡(luò)請(qǐng)求
本文地址:http://jinyejixie.com/article47/dgijdej.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供商城網(wǎng)站、動(dòng)態(tài)網(wǎng)站、全網(wǎng)營(yíng)銷推廣、網(wǎng)站收錄、外貿(mào)建站、用戶體驗(yàn)
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來(lái)源: 創(chuàng)新互聯(lián)